Default Picking up a new bike, check the deal please

Hey guys-

I'm planning on picking up an '08 Softail FXSTC tomorrow from my local dealer and wanted you guys to check the deal to make sure everything is in line.

2008 Softail FXSTC
5038 Miles
$13,501 Out the door price (does not include tax)

profiled wheel
chrome fork brace
detachable windshield
security system

pegs
HD shifter rod

brake pedal
chrome switch covers
slip-on exhaust
has been serviced, no warranty
